High-Performance Silicon Carbide Ceramics Driving Industrial Innovation

2024 03/17

Silicon carbide (SiC) ceramics are recognized for their outstanding mechanical strength at high temperatures, superior oxidation resistance, exceptional wear resistance, and excellent thermal stability. With a low thermal expansion coefficient, high thermal conductivity, and extreme hardness, SiC ceramics deliver reliable performance in the most demanding environments.
 
Key Features:
 
  • Low Density: Approximately 3.20 g/cm³ at room temperature, significantly lighter than steel.
 
  • Extreme Hardness:Mohs hardness of 9.5, second only to diamond.
 
  • Thermal Stability:High thermal conductivity, low expansion coefficient, and excellent thermal shock resistance.
 
  • High-Temperature Resistance: Operational capability above 1,300 °C.
 
  • Corrosion Resistance: Withstands strong acids and alkalis.
 
  • Wear Resistance: Low friction coefficient, oxidation resistance, and outstanding durability.
sic
Applications Across Industries:
 
SiC ceramics are widely used in petroleum, chemical processing, microelectronics, automotive, aerospace, aviation, paper manufacturing, laser systems, mining, and nuclear energy sectors. Typical applications include high-temperature bearings, ballistic protection plates, spray nozzles, corrosion-resistant components, and electronic parts for high-frequency and high-temperature operations.
